然而,要让MySQL数据库在计算机上顺畅运行,背后离不开一系列关键库文件的支持
这些库文件,就是我们今天要深入探讨的“mysql libs”
mysql libs,简而言之,是MySQL数据库的核心库文件集合
这些库文件包含了运行MySQL所需的各种基础函数和类库,它们如同MySQL数据库的“骨架”和“灵魂”,支撑着整个数据库系统的运作
无论是数据库的启动、查询、更新,还是客户端与服务器端的通信,都离不开这些库文件的支持
具体来说,mysql libs主要承担以下几大功能: 一、提供基础功能支持 mysql libs中包含了大量预编译的代码集合,这些代码实现了MySQL数据库的基本功能
例如,数据的存储和检索、索引的创建和维护、事务的处理等,都离不开这些基础库文件的支持
这些库文件通常以静态库(.a文件)或动态库(.so文件)的形式存在,如libmysqlclient.a和libmysqlclient.so等,它们为MySQL数据库提供了坚实的底层基础
二、保障客户端与服务器端通信 在MySQL数据库中,客户端与服务器端的通信是至关重要的
mysql libs中的库文件负责处理这种通信,确保数据能够在客户端和服务器之间顺畅传输
这种通信机制的实现,依赖于库文件中定义的协议和数据格式,它们保证了数据的准确性和一致性
三、确保兼容性与扩展性 不同版本的MySQL数据库可能需要不同的库文件支持
mysql libs通过提供特定版本的库文件,确保了数据库与其他软件或系统的兼容性
同时,这些库文件也具有一定的扩展性,可以随着MySQL数据库功能的增强而不断更新和完善
在安装和使用MySQL数据库时,正确安装和配置mysql libs是至关重要的
以下是一些建议的步骤和注意事项: 1.检查系统环境:在安装mysql libs之前,务必检查系统是否已经安装了MySQL或与之冲突的其他数据库软件
同时,确保系统满足mysql libs的安装要求,如操作系统版本、内存大小等
2.下载与解压:从MySQL官方网站或其他可靠来源下载mysql libs的安装包
下载完成后,将其解压到合适的目录,以便进行后续的安装操作
3.安装mysql libs:根据系统的不同,选择合适的安装命令(如rpm、yum等)来安装mysql libs
在安装过程中,注意解决可能出现的依赖关系和冲突问题
如果遇到缺少某些依赖包的情况,可以根据提示信息使用相应的命令进行安装
4.配置MySQL:安装完成后,根据实际情况配置MySQL数据库
这包括设置root密码、创建用户和数据库、调整数据库参数等
确保所有配置都符合实际需求,以保证数据库的安全性和性能
此外,在使用mysql libs过程中,还需要注意以下几点: - 保持更新:随着技术的不断发展,MySQL数据库及其相关库文件也会不断更新
为了确保系统的安全性和性能,建议定期关注MySQL官方发布的更新信息,并及时将mysql libs更新到最新版本
- 备份与恢复:在进行任何重要的数据库操作之前,务必做好备份工作
这样,在出现问题时,可以迅速恢复到之前的状态,避免数据丢失带来的损失
- 优化与调整:根据实际应用场景的需求,对MySQL数据库和mysql libs进行适当的优化和调整
例如,可以通过调整缓存大小、连接数等参数来提高数据库的性能
总之,mysql libs作为MySQL数据库的核心库文件集合,对于确保数据库的正常运行和高效性能至关重要
通过深入了解其功能和作用,并遵循正确的安装与使用步骤,我们可以更好地管理和维护MySQL数据库系统,从而为企业和开发者提供更加稳定、可靠的数据存储和检索服务